When you look at insurance under 65, the monthly payment depends on several pieces of your personal profile. Providers primarily evaluate your age, your current health history, and where you live, as state regulations shift how plans are priced. Whether you use tobacco products also plays a significant role in your premium. Ultimately, your choice of deductible and the level of out-of-pocket protection you want are the biggest levers you can pull to adjust your budget.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
Seeking the lowest possible premium often means selecting a plan with a higher deductible, meaning you pay more when you actually see a doctor. This is a common strategy for healthy individuals who primarily want coverage for emergencies. Prices vary based on your state of residence and your personal health history.
